USDA announces Conservation Innovation Grants

Agriculture Secretary Tom Vilsack announced $22.5 million in innovative conservation technologies and approaches on Monday.

Vilsack said that the 52 grants will be carried out in 40 states, but that eight of them will support conservation innovations in the Chesapeake Bay Watershed, and another eight will focus on the Mississippi River Basin.

The grants will address erosion prevention and demonstrate the effectiveness of new ways to reduce odors from poultry and livestock operations, reclaim mining lands, develop ecosystem markets and expand solar energy use on farms.

Grant winners pay 50 percent of project cost, USDA said in a news release.
